Kirsty, the founder of little batch, makes handmade chocolate treats and wholesome energy balls, and seasonally produced syrups.
little batch syrups come in three flavours for autumn/winter, spiced elderberry, chai-spiced plum and award-winning wild blackberry. Their spring/summer range contains our award-winning rhubarb & rose and the beautiful honeysuckle & hibiscus. They are also delightful in cocktails or mocktails.
Kirsty also makes organic loose-leaf herbal tea blends that offer the best possible flavour quality and the chance to eliminate the waste of a single-use teabag.
And little batch’s most popular product is the Decadent Balls, these handmade mouthfuls of joy are a wholesome take on popular treats.
They have a base of seeds, oats and nuts, topped with a peanut date caramel, their award winning peanut munch decadent ball is reminiscent of a Snickers bar.
